Your Yosemite Adventure Starts in Merced Long known as the Gateway to Yosemite, Merced offers a convenient starting point for exploring one of the world’s most iconic national parks. Located along Highway 140, the year-round route into Yosemite Valley, Merced connects travelers to the park by car, train, plane, and public transportation. Spend the night in Merced, enjoy local restaurants and attractions, and begin your Yosemite adventure refreshed and ready to explore. Visitors can drive the scenic Highway 140 route or leave the driving behind and ride YARTS from one of several convenient pickup locations throughout Merced.
